Fannie Mae Appoints Priscilla Almodovar Chief Executive Officer
Fannie Mae, Washington, D.C. appointed Priscilla Almodovar its CEO and member of its Board of Directors effective December 5. She has served as President and CEO of Enterprise Community Partners since 2019.

Almodovar will succeed David C. Benson, who has served as Fannie Mae’s Interim CEO and a member of the Board of Directors since May 2022. After her arrival, Benson will continue in his role as President.

Prior to her role at Enterprise Community Partners, Almodovar worked for nearly a decade at JPMorgan Chase and led two of the firm’s national real estate businesses; most recently, as Managing Director, Co-Head of Real Estate Banking where she served national and regional real estate developers, investors, owners and investment funds.

Earlier in her career, Almodovar was President and CEO at New York State Housing Finance Agency, State of New York Mortgage Agency and Affordable Housing Corporation. She started her career at White & Case LLP, where she was named an equity partner.

Access Point Financial Promotes Ankur Shah to CFO

Direct lender Access Point Financial LLC promoted Ankur Shah to CFO and head of capital markets.

Shah previously served as Managing Director and Co-Head of Capital Markets and Corporate Development. As CFO, he will establish, structure and manage capital and industry relationships, overseeing corporate strategy and financial operations. He will also serve on the company’s executive committee from the firm’s McLean, Va. office.

Shah previously worked as finance manager for DiamondRock Hospitality Co., where he was active in more than $1 billion in hotel investments and more than $1 billion of equity and debt financings, and was a Senior Real Estate Analyst with Choice Hotels International.

Bill Grice Appointed CBRE Hotels President

CBRE, Dallas, appointed Bill Grice President for CBRE Hotels in the United States.

Grice will lead CBRE’s hotel business that combines investment sales, finance, valuation, advisory and research into a single fully integrated service offering. CBRE Hotels served as intermediary for $165 billion in engagements and the number one firm for hospitality investment sales activity globally in 2021.

Grice is based in Atlanta and has more than 20 years of hospitality and capital markets experience. He joined CBRE in 2020 and most recently served as Co-Head of Hospitality Capital Markets. He was previously a member of the hotel investment banking team at JLL and prior to that worked in large loan originations at GE Capital Real Estate. He has been involved in over $40 billion of lodging-related recapitalization, financing, and equity placement during his career.

Grice succeeds Kevin Mallory, who will retire at the end of the year after more than 18 years with the firm.
